就像在嵌入系統中使用C語言替代匯編一樣,在嵌入系統中使用RTOS是大勢所趨。原因主要是現在在大多數情況下編程效率比執行效率重要(單片機便宜嘛)。但縱觀51的RTOS,keil c51 所帶的RTX Full 太大(6k多),且需要外部ram,又無源代碼,很多時候不實用。RTX Tiny雖然小(900多字節),但是任務沒有優先級和中斷管理,也無源代碼,也不太實用。而ucosII雖有源代碼,但是它太大,又需要外部ram,所有函數又必須是重入函數,用在51這類小片內RAM的單片機上有點勉強。于是,我借鑒ucosII和RTX Tiny編寫了Small RTOS 51,雖然它為51系列編寫,但是它還是比較容易移植到其它CPU上。
標簽: RTOS 嵌入系統 效率 C語言
上傳時間: 2014-01-17
上傳用戶:變形金剛
信息隱藏!!!這個程序的功能主要是在一副位圖里面嵌套信息,從而達到信息隱藏的目的.
標簽: 信息隱藏 位圖 程序 嵌套
上傳時間: 2014-01-14
上傳用戶:zukfu
是一個驅動開發包。主要是針對單片機的.希望大家
標簽: 驅動 開發包 單片機 家
上傳時間: 2014-09-10
上傳用戶:dragonhaixm
主要是實現在linux操作系統中對實現USB事件的監測。
標簽: linux USB 操作系統 監測
上傳時間: 2016-10-10
上傳用戶:wsf950131
本章主要是結合DAO設計模式,減少JSP中的代碼數量,體現了數據與顯示的分離
標簽: DAO 設計模式
上傳時間: 2013-12-31
上傳用戶:dreamboy36
本文檔主要是介紹了h.323的基本介紹,和323的應用方面的中文文檔
標簽: 323 文檔
上傳時間: 2016-10-15
上傳用戶:問題問題
WinCE下USB無線網卡驅動程序,主要是用于WINCE5.0和WINCE6.0.
標簽: WINCE WinCE USB 5.0
上傳時間: 2016-10-16
上傳用戶:小寶愛考拉
這是BAC(二值算數編碼) 這是我自己提供的 主要是可是可適應性的編碼功能
標簽: BAC 編碼 可適應性
上傳時間: 2013-12-18
上傳用戶:shinesyh
這是自己寫出來的快速傅利葉轉換 採用256arry陣列集合而成
標簽: arry 256
上傳時間: 2014-01-16
上傳用戶:1583060504
430程序例子,主要是供大家參考用的,編寫程序的時候可以抄襲一下的,
標簽: 430 程序 家
上傳時間: 2016-10-21
上傳用戶:txfyddz
蟲蟲下載站版權所有 京ICP備2021023401號-1